Ingredients


– 4 large poblano peppers
– 1 pound ground turkey
– 1 cup diced onion
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 cup diced tomatoes (fresh or canned)
– 1 tablespoon chili powder
– 1 teaspoon cumin
– 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
– 1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or Monterey Jack)
– Salt and pepper, to taste
– Olive oil, for drizzling
– Fresh cilantro, for garnish (optional)


Step-by-Step Instructions


Preparing Chiles Rellenos can be an enjoyable and simple task. Here’s how to make them:
1.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
2. Prepare the Peppers: Place the poblano peppers on a baking sheet and roast in the preheated oven for 15-20 minutes until the skin is blistered and slightly charred. Remove and place in a bowl covered with plastic wrap to steam for about 10 minutes.
3. Cook the Turkey: In a skillet over medium heat, add a drizzle of olive oil. Add diced onions and sauté until translucent. Stir in garlic and cook for an additional minute.
4. Add Ground Turkey: Incorporate the ground turkey, breaking it up with a spatula. Cook until browned and fully cooked, about 6-7 minutes.
5. Mix the Filling: Stir in the diced tomatoes, chili powder, cumin, smoked paprika, and season with salt and pepper. Cook for another 5 minutes until everything is well mixed. Remove from heat and stir in half of the cheese, letting it melt into the mixture.
6. Stuff the Peppers: Carefully peel the blistered skin off the roasted poblanos. Make a slit in each pepper and remove the seeds (be careful to keep them intact). Stuff each pepper generously with the turkey mixture.
7. Bake the Stuffed Peppers: Place the stuffed peppers in a baking dish. Sprinkle the remaining cheese on top and drizzle with olive oil. Cover with foil and bake for 20 minutes.
8. Finish Baking: Remove the foil and bake for an additional 10 minutes, allowing the cheese to melt and become golden brown.
9. Serve and Garnish: Remove from the oven and let cool slightly. Garnish with fresh cilantro before serving.

Additional Tips


– Use Fresh Peppers: Fresh, firm poblano peppers will not only taste better but also hold up well during cooking.
– Spice it Up: For those who enjoy a little heat, consider adding diced jalapeños or more chili powder to the turkey mixture.
– Cheese Choices: While cheddar and Monterey Jack work beautifully, feel free to experiment with other cheeses like Pepper Jack for extra flavor.
– Toppings: Consider topping with sour cream, avocado, or a zesty salsa for an additional layer of flavor.

Recipe Variation


There are countless ways to customize your Chiles Rellenos. Here are some creative variations:
1. Vegetarian Option: Substitute the ground turkey with black beans, quinoa, or a medley of sautéed vegetables for a delicious meatless version.
2. Cheese Lover’s Dream: Add a cheese stuffing inside the poblano peppers before the turkey, or even mix in cream cheese into the filling for a creamy texture.
3. Different Proteins: Swap the ground turkey for shredded chicken, beef, or even tofu for a different spin on the dish.
4. Southwest Flavor: Add corn and diced bell peppers to the turkey filling for an extra burst of color and flavor.

Freezing and Storage


Storage: Keep your Chiles Rellenos in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days after cooking. This helps maintain their delicious flavor.
Freezing: These stuffed peppers can be frozen before or after baking. If freezing unbaked, wrap each pepper tightly in plastic wrap and then in aluminum foil. They can last in the freezer for up to three months. If you’ve already baked them, let them cool completely, then store the leftovers in airtight containers or freezer bags.

Frequently Asked Questions


Can I use other types of peppers instead of poblanos?
Yes, you can experiment with Anaheim or bell peppers. Just keep in mind that the heat and flavor will differ.
How do I know when the peppers are done roasting?
Look for the skin to be blistered and slightly charred; this indicates they are roasted and ready for peeling.
Is this dish gluten-free?
Yes, as long as you use gluten-free spices and sauces, Chiles Rellenos can be a gluten-free dish. Always check labels for hidden gluten.
Can I make these 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can prepare the filling and roast the peppers a day before. Just assemble and bake when you’re ready to serve.
What’s the best way to reheat leftovers?
Reheat in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 15-20 minutes, or until heated through. This will help keep the peppers from becoming soggy.
